eCommerce website Designer

EvoPages is great!

Penjamillo eCommerce website Designer Michoacan de Ocampo, Mexico

Mexico (MX)

Michoacan de Ocampo Region

Penjamillo City

Latitude: 20.1 Longitude -101.9